Rebranding is repositioning a business that has outgrown its brand — new audience, new price point, a merger, or a name that no longer matches what you sell. It is not brand identity design in Ballarat, which builds a system for a position you already hold; it is not branding strategyalone, which defines that position for the first time; and it is not graphic design, which produces assets inside settled rules. Start here when the business has changed and the brand has not caught up.

Most Ballarat Rebrands Redraw the Logo and Leave the Position Untouched.
The common Ballarat rebrand trigger is a regional service or health provider that has expanded its catchment and capability while the brand still reads as a small local operator, undermining its position when competing against Melbourne-based providers for the same referrals or contracts.
The second issue is heritage confusion. Ballarat's tourism identity leans heavily on its goldfields heritage, and a business unrelated to tourism can inadvertently borrow that heritage tone in its brand, reading as a tourism operator rather than a health, food or professional services business.

How a Rebrand Actually Runs.
Ballarat Brand Diagnosis
Diagnosis covers interviews with customers, referrers and staff, a review of sales and referral pathways, competitor mapping against Melbourne-based and regional rivals, and an equity audit of what central Victoria genuinely recognises.
Repositioning & Identity
Positioning is written for a regional catchment and carried by a messaging framework, while the identity system reads as capable and current rather than borrowing tourism-heritage tone it doesn't need.
Staged Rollout & Migration
Release runs in order: web first, then referral and sales collateral, listings and physical assets, with redirects, canonical work and structured data keeping organic performance intact.
